Uncle Muhammad
This book primarily focuses on the life and times of Muhammad Ali.
Uncle Muhammad was a legendary boxer who was involved in some of the greatest fights of all time. He was also a revolutionary political figure who used his fame and influence to teach others. He often referred to himself as the greatest heavyweight champion of all time!
Uncle Muhammad was an outstanding boxer who started boxing at 12 years old. As an amateur boxer Uncle Muhammad won over 100 fights, he won many awards and even a gold medal at the Olympic games.
When Uncle Muhammad retired from his boxing career, in 1981, he had won over 56 professional fights. During his retirement, he went on to carry the torch at the 1996 Olympic Games in Atlanta. He earned the Presidential Medal of Freedom in 2005 because he used fame to help countries in need.
